Antarctic Circle
The parallel at 66 degrees 32 minutes south. Due to the inclination of the earth's axis, the sun does not set on one day in the southern midsummer. Similarly, the sun does not rise on one day in the souther midwinter. Within the Antarctic Circle, the number of such days increases, the closer you are to the south pole.
